本文将详细解释如何在Visual Studio (VS) 中创建Python文件路径,并提供相关代码示例。通过以下几个方面的阐述,帮助读者了解如何在VS中创建Python文件路径。
一、VS创建Python文件路径的基本概念
在使用VS创建Python文件路径之前,我们首先需要了解一些基本概念。一个完整的Python文件路径通常包括文件夹路径和文件名。文件夹路径用于指定文件所在的文件夹,文件名则指定了具体的文件。
VS提供了多种创建Python文件路径的方法,如直接在代码中指定路径、使用相对路径等。接下来,我们将详细介绍这些方法。
二、直接在代码中指定路径
在VS中,我们可以直接在代码中指定Python文件路径。这种方法适用于在代码中引用特定文件的场景。
import os # 定义文件路径 file_path = "C:\Users\username\Documents\myfile.py" # 使用文件路径 with open(file_path, "r") as file: data = file.read() print(data)
以上代码示例中,我们通过字符串直接指定了要打开的文件路径。请确保你有相应的文件路径,并根据实际情况进行修改。
三、使用相对路径
相对路径是相对于当前工作目录的路径。在使用相对路径时,我们可以通过使用特定的路径符号来指定文件的位置。
以下是一些常用的路径符号:
.
:表示当前目录..
:表示父目录/
或:表示路径分隔符
import os # 获取当前工作目录 current_dir = os.getcwd() # 定义相对路径 relative_path = os.path.join(current_dir, "subfolder", "myfile.py") # 使用相对路径 with open(relative_path, "r") as file: data = file.read() print(data)
在以上代码示例中,我们通过获取当前工作目录和使用os.path.join()
函数来定义相对路径。这样就可以使用相对路径打开指定的文件。
四、使用环境变量配置路径
另外一种创建Python文件路径的方法是使用环境变量配置路径。这样可以使路径更加灵活,便于在不同环境下迁移代码。
import os # 使用环境变量配置路径 file_path = os.environ["MY_FILE_PATH"] with open(file_path, "r") as file: data = file.read() print(data)
以上代码示例中,我们使用os.environ["MY_FILE_PATH"]
来获取名为MY_FILE_PATH
的环境变量所对应的文件路径。
五、结语
通过本文的介绍,我们详细讲解了在VS中创建Python文件路径的几种方法。根据实际需求,我们可以选择直接在代码中指定路径、使用相对路径或者使用环境变量配置路径。希望本文对你在VS中创建Python文件路径有所帮助。